A ratio shows us the number of times a number contains another number. Caitlin is right.
<h3>What is a Ratio?</h3>
A ratio shows us the number of times a number contains another number.
The ratio of the ages of Mandy and Sandy is 2:5. Therefore, the ratio will be,
M/S = 2/5
M = 2S/5
After 8 years, their ages will be in the ratio 1:2, therefore,
(M+8)/(S+8) = 1/2
2M + 16 = S + 8
2M - S = -16 + 8
Substitute the value of M,
2(2S/5) - S = -8
-0.2S = -8
S = 40
Now, if we substitute the value of S in the first ratio,
M/S = 2/5
M/40 = 2/5
M = 16
Now, if we take the difference in their ages the difference will be 24(40-16).
Since the difference is 24, we can conclude that Caitlin is right.
Hence, Caitlin is right.
